This topic provides recommendations for protecting and recovering data stored in InfoPath form templates.

Versioning

  • **Content versioning   **Recommended. Be sure to provide site owners with a clear understanding of the amount of space available relative to the number of versions, and work with site owners to ensure that versioned sites are actively monitored and managed.

    Note

    If you upgrade a form template, and then open a previously-created XML file in a library, the previous version can only be opened using Microsoft Office InfoPath 2007, rather than a Web browser.

  • **Database snapshot   **Not recommended. Database snapshots are recommended only for environments in which you want to protect the look and feel of a site as versions change over time.

Deletion protection

  • **Recycle Bin   **Recommended. Users can recover filled-in forms and user-deployed form templates from the recycle bin

  • Site capture   Recommended. Protecting collaboration sites against accidental deletion is strongly recommended.

Backup and recovery

If you are running Windows SharePoint Services 3.0, the user-defined form templates and any data stored in databases hosting SharePoint content are backed up when your content databases are backed up.

Protecting external data

Any time you retrieve data that is stored externally to Windows SharePoint Services, or save InfoPath forms data to an external database, be sure to include that data in your backup and recovery planning. The built-in backup and recovery tools provided with Windows SharePoint Services will not protect the data.

If you have created form templates that store data in a database, include the database in your backup and recovery strategy.
